We may edit your biography for stylistic consistency, but we won't change the information without your approval. These suggestions may be helpful:

1. Your biography should be professional and not personal. We do not include personal information, dedications, thank yous, etc.

2. Your biography will appear in paragraph form. Write in full sentences.* Every word counts as part of your biography, beginning with your name.

*To conserve words, you might choose to "list" credits after a sentence or two at the first of your biography. For example:

Costume design for film: Casablanca, Ben Hur. Broadway: Hamlet, Guys and Dolls, University of Maryland: Romeo and Juliet, Suburbia = 18 words

3. Your name, as you wish it to appear in the program, must be the first words of your biography. The next words should indicate your (position with this production) and then your faculty, staff, or student status with the Department of Theatre. For example:

Pat Smith (director) is an assistant professor of theatre whose credits ...

4. In subsequent mentions refer to yourself in the third person or by last name.

5. Use credits with which the Department of Theatre audience members may be most familiar.

6. Use full names of productions (The Taming of the Shrew, not Shrew), full names of theatre companies ("Olney Theatre Center for the Arts," not "Olney"), and full names of organizations ("American Society for Theatre Research," not "ASTR").

7. There is no need to indicate that a recent campus production was a Department of Theatre production or in which theatre it was presented. Save your words--most readers will have seen the production and will know this information.
